Iwobi Joins Premier League Elite with Assist in Fulham’s Draw Against Manchester United

Alex Iwobi has joined an exclusive group of Nigerian Premier League stars after recording an assist in Fulham’s 1-1 draw with Manchester United at Craven Cottage on Sunday. The 29-year-old midfielder set up substitute Emile Smith Rowe for Fulham’s equaliser in the tightly contested encounter.

With this assist, Iwobi now boasts 67 goal contributions in the Premier League — comprising 31 goals and 36 assists. He becomes the third Nigerian player to reach this milestone, following in the footsteps of Shola Ameobi and Kelechi Iheanacho.

Only two Nigerian players have recorded more Premier League goal contributions than Iwobi: Yakubu Aiyegbeni with 121 and Nwankwo Kanu with 83.

Beyond the assist, Iwobi delivered a standout performance against Manchester United, completing the full 90 minutes and showcasing the versatility and composure that have defined his career since emerging from Arsenal’s academy.
